Output e7a89604f2d09bf5bae2319b4621cce9eb1dddfb17a18d618d34a8e8e1796d9a:1

value
41615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82ec1acab2ec0bac2f148ceb22c1e0666b6f5836 OP_EQUAL
address
3DdGcKZJf3ELmJmE6cavenQriqZxcLks53
transaction
e7a89604f2d09bf5bae2319b4621cce9eb1dddfb17a18d618d34a8e8e1796d9a
confirmations
302674
spent
true